Firehouse Subs is an American fast casual restaurant chain specializing in submarine sandwiches. Founded in 1994 in Jacksonville, Florida, by firefighter brothers Chris and Robin Sorensen, the chain emphasizes its firefighter heritage. Firehouse Subs is now a subsidiary of Restaurant Brands International, a parent company that also owns Burger King, Popeyes, and Tim Hortons.
On October 10, 1994, the first Firehouse Subs restaurant was opened in Jacksonville, Florida.
In 1994, Firehouse Subs was founded in Jacksonville, Florida, by brothers Chris and Robin Sorensen, who were former firefighters.
In 1995, Firehouse Subs first attempted franchising, but the founders decided to focus on operating company-owned stores.
In 1998, Firehouse Subs surpassed 10 locations and opened its first location outside of Florida.
In 2000, the founders of Firehouse Subs decided to use consultants to plan franchise growth and set up financing for potential franchisees.
The second wave of franchising for Firehouse Subs began in 2001.
In 2011, Firehouse Subs opened its first franchises in the U.S. territory of Puerto Rico.
By 2012, Firehouse Subs reached 500 locations, ending the year with nearly 600.
In 2015, Firehouse Subs opened its first location in Canada, specifically in Oshawa, Ontario, and also launched a loyalty program.
In July 2016, Firehouse Subs opened its 1,000th location.
In June 2017, Firehouse Subs opened its first airport location at Jacksonville International.
In December 2017, Firehouse Subs opened its second airport location at Orlando International.
In 2017, Jay Miller joined Firehouse Subs as the director of product development, working alongside Chris and Robin to develop the menu.
In April 2018, Firehouse Subs opened its first on-campus location at Western New England University.
In 2020, Firehouse Subs opened a location at Jacksonville's Baptist Medical Center.
On November 15, 2021, Restaurant Brands International, the parent company of Burger King, announced its plan to acquire Firehouse Subs for $1 billion.
On December 15, 2021, the acquisition of Firehouse Subs by Restaurant Brands International was completed.
On June 22, 2023, Firehouse Subs opened its first location outside of North America in Zurich, Switzerland.
By 2025, Firehouse Subs plans to expand its locations to the United Kingdom and Australia.
In 2026, Firehouse Subs plans to open its first location in Brazil.
